What Is Auto Detailing?
Auto detailing refers to an in-depth cleaning and restoration of vehicles. In comparison to a typical car wash, detailing covers every part of the car with accuracy. Professionals clean, protect and improve the interior and exterior of the vehicle with specialized tools, high-quality products and proven techniques.
Detailing usually includes:
Exterior Care - Washing hands, waxing, polishing and applying protective coating.
Interior Care - Shampooing carpets, cleaning upholstery, conditioning leather, and sanitizing vents.
Paint Protection - Coating with sealants, wax or ceramic to avoid fading and scratches.
Engine Bay Cleaning - Removal of grime and dirt to achieve improved performance and durability.

Types of Auto Detailing Services
Detailing services vary based on packages and providers, but most fall into the following categories:
1. Exterior Detailing
Hand wash and dry
Clay bar treatment to remove contaminants
Polishing to restore paint shine
Wax or sealant application for protection
2. Interior Detailing
Vacuuming carpets and seats
Deep cleaning and stain removal
Leather conditioning
Odor elimination treatments
3. Full-Service Detailing
A complete package covering both interior and exterior for a full refresh.
4. Paint Correction
For vehicles with swirl marks or scratches, technicians use polishing compounds to restore paint clarity.
5. Ceramic Coating
A long-lasting protective layer that keeps the car’s paint glossy and resistant to damage.

Parker Auto Detailing Costs.
Prices differ according to the size of the vehicle and the type of service, but in this area, you can expect the following:
• Basic Wash & Wax – $50–$100
• Interior Detail – $100–$200
• Full-Service Detailing – $150–$300
• Paint Correction – $300–$600+
• Ceramic Coating - $800-1500+ (coating and warranty)

FAQs
Q1: Does it describe the same thing as a car wash?
No. A car wash is a surface cleaner, whereas detailing is a deeper cleaner--restoring and protecting every bit of your car.
Q2: What is the duration of a complete auto detail?
Normally, 2-5 hours based on the level of service and size of the vehicle.
Q3: Does detailing eliminate scratches?
Scratches and swirl marks that are minor can be fixed by polishing and paint repair.
